1. forward to the very serious investigation by the United States
2. Attorney of who may have conspired in this case, and that is
3. very hopeful, and we're hoping that everyone who may have a
4. role to this criminal prosecution will submit that evidence.
5. This is about power. This is about many victims
6. having lived in fear -- fear of the rich, the powerful, the
7. famous, fear that the system will not afford them justice. So
8. fear of not coming forward. And fear, of course, is a weapon
9. that the rich, powerful, famous, and sexual predators used to
10. silence the victims. But that is gone for a lot of victims
11. because they refuse to suffer in silence.
12. Finally, it does take courage to speak truth to power.
13. We thank this honorable court for giving these victims a voice.
14. We thank them, even after the death of the defendant, for
15. showing respect for the victims, allowing them dignity,
16. allowing them a voice. We do want truth, we do want justice,
17. we do want accountability, and we do want those conspirators to
18. face the justice system.
19. Your Honor, right now we have two of our clients who
20. would like to address the court.
21. THE COURT: Sure.
22. MS. ALLRED: Then I have a couple of statements on
23. victims who do not wish to address the court.
24. As they come up, we'll give them the opportunity to
25. say either their name or Jane Doe.
